-When you get there to check in everyone is super nice and helpful! We were given some simple instructions and rules for the campsite and a map of the campground which was super helpful! It can be a little confusing to find your way at first but the map really helps along with the directions from the welcome center staff.
The host is there daily to be of assistance in any way, I believe they also drive around at least once every morning making sure things are running smoothly and to be if help if need be.
-The bathrooms are wonderful for campground bathrooms! They have a few stalls in both the women and men’s, with doors that lock tile floor, mirrors and soap along with well running sinks! They were always clean and up kept daily.
-Each campsite has their own table and fire pit. All the campsites around ours that we could see were clean and nicely laid out.
